Spotting Signs of Concerning Behavior
The majority of people engage in gaming for entertainment and stop when they ought to. But it’s smart to recognize the indicators when a activity transforms into something more. These signs transcend just experiencing Extra Chilli Slot. Be alert to someone consistently selecting the game over career or family duties. Observe if they start being dishonest about how much they engage or wager. Worry if gambling becomes their primary means to deal with anxiety or an argument. Growing visibly frustrated when they can’t play is another clue. With money, warning signs involve chasing losses, taking cash to play, or letting bills slide. Identifying these indicators early enables you to shift gears. It no longer is a basic disagreement and becomes about offering help and finding more assistance if it’s required.

Tools and Follow-Up Actions for Expert Support
If your home talks aren’t making things easier, or if you notice those danger signs clearly, getting outside help is a smart move. You have options. A marriage or household counsellor can give you a neutral space and superior tools for dialogue. If the worries are especially about gambling patterns, organisations like GamCare, Gambling Therapy, and the National Gambling Helpline are available. They provide free, private advice and help.
